@999berak no, it wasn't. Untill 1927 all movies were silent, someone was distributed with a specific music score (as "Le Ballet Mecanique" that you can see on my Vimeo channel) or with a few suggestions of what to play. Each cinema has its own musicians: they created a live soundtrack during the screening. No soundtrack was recorded on film before 1927.

@pucksterz12 This movie signs the passage from primitive cinema to classic cinema. It s the first western movie, but its importance is the editing. Earlier movies were shorter, this movie was like a colossal a that time. This was a very complex story to tell, without specific rules for the editing. But Potter made a very easy movie to understand, giving a great contribute for the developpening of a cinematographic grammar.
